A Phase II Study of AK146D1 Mono or Combined With AK112 in Advanced Urothelial Carcinoma

NCT07636772 · Status: NOT_YET_RECRUITING · Phase: PHASE2 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 132

Last updated 2026-06-09

No results posted yet for this study

Summary

This is a Phase II clinical study aimed at evaluating the safety, tolerability, antitumor efficacy, PK and immunogenicity of AK146D1 monotherapy or combined with AK112 in advanced Urothelial carcinoma.

Conditions

  • Urothelial Carcinoma (UC)

Interventions

DRUG

AK146D1 for injection

AK146D1 for injection is an antiTrop2/Nectin4 bispecific antibody-drug conjugate

DRUG

AK112 Injection

AK112 Injection is a PD-1/VEGF bispecific antibody
